Phase one: Knowing the Interface
Right before animating, you’ll have to get comfy with Blender’s interface. Once you open Blender for the first time, the default structure shows a cube, a camera, and a light. The primary areas you'll use for animation include the 3D Viewport, Timeline, Dope Sheet, and Graph Editor.
Use the center mouse button to rotate all over objects, scroll to zoom, and Shift + middle mouse to pan. You can swap amongst diverse editors using the tabs or dropdowns in each panel.
Move 2: Keyframe Animation Essentials
Blender utilizes keyframes to animate changes eventually. To display this, let’s animate a essential cube.
Select the dice.
Move to body 1 to the Timeline.
Press I and pick out Spot to insert a keyframe.
Move to frame sixty, grab the dice (press G), go it alongside the X-axis, and push I all over again to insert A different place keyframe.
After you press the spacebar to Participate in the animation, you’ll see the dice shift easily from its primary situation to The brand new a person. Blender interpolates the movement in between keyframes routinely.
Move three: Adding Rotation and Scale
It's also possible to animate an item’s rotation and scale. Use R to rotate and S to scale the article. Every time you come up with a alter, press I to insert a keyframe for that home (Rotation or Scaling). Combining movement, rotation, and scaling contributes to extra dynamic animations.
Step 4: Dealing with the Dope Sheet and Graph Editor
The Dope Sheet offers an overview of all keyframes and lets you change timing conveniently by dragging keyframes remaining or suitable. The Graph Editor provides additional exact Handle above motion curves, permitting you clean or exaggerate animations working with Bezier handles.
Action 5: Rendering the Animation
After you're happy with your animation:
Visit the Output Homes tab.

Decide on a file format like FFmpeg for online video output.
Pick out the output spot.
Hit Render > Render Animation with the best menu.
Your animation will probably be processed and saved as a movie file.
